South Bend Central Development Area <br />(1) continued... <br />Mr. Hollingsworth responded that he would consider that except for the restrictions of the <br />program requiring a 1 -year lease and the income restrictions. <br />Upon a motion by Ms. Schey, seconded by Mr. Downes and unanimously carried, the <br />Commission approved Resolution No. 3153 designating and declaring an amendment to the <br />Development Plan for the South Bend Central Development Area which includes adding <br />and expanding the range of Downtown Housing and types to include specific groups, to <br />revise and modernize the plan which was written 30 years ago, add some time frames and to <br />incorporate the recent discussion about complete streets. <br />(2) Resolution No. 3154 approving and authorizing the execution of an Addendum to the <br />Master Agency Agreement (Hill & Colfax Drainage Improvements Project) <br />Mr. Dressel noted that staff approached the Commission in June to present plans for <br />development of the Commission -owned property on the northwest corner of Hill Street and <br />Colfax Avenue as a mixed use building planned by Colfax Hill Partners, LLC. Prior to <br />development, there's a need to address site drainage. <br />The proposed project consists of eliminating an existing detention basin and drywell system <br />on the site and providing a new detention storage facility, while maintaining the current <br />outlet rate to the City drainage system. It is likely that the drywell structures in the adjacent <br />parking lot are also connected to this detention basin. Abonmarche has submitted a written <br />proposal to provide the following scope of services: <br />• Performing a field survey /conducting utility locates <br />• Preliminary engineering including providing a storage location and method options <br />• Preparing construction documents and complete bid package <br />• Providing bid period services including recommendation for contract award <br />The proposed work plan calls for completion of services above within 5 weeks; start of the <br />City of South Bend bid process in mid - September; and project construction commencing by <br />mid - October. Staff requests approval of Resolution No. 3145 and Addendum to the Master <br />Agency Agreement, in a not -to- exceed amount of $8,200. <br />Mr. Downes asked if there is an estimate of the cost to relocate the drainage system. Mr. <br />Ford hesitated to put a hard number out there, but did not think it would be a large number. <br />Mr. Varner asked that if it is possible after the assessment if the detention base will be <br />adequate or not.
